Osprey's examine of the United States' first offensive reaction to the Pearl Harbor assaults of global battle II (1939-1945). In early 1942, the strategic state of affairs was once bleak for the USA. She have been in continuous retreat for the reason that Pearl Harbor, surrendering significant parts comparable to the Philippines, and used to be getting ready for the worst in Hawaii and at the West Coast. the japanese, nonetheless, had secured a well-defended perimeter, and have been set for extra growth. whatever had to ensue speedy and be of substantial impact. The April 1942 Doolittle Raid on Japan was once how to do so. This booklet examines the making plans, execution, and aftermath of this cutting edge, bold and dicy assault, which might exhibit that the japanese military and air forces have been something yet invincible.
